i have been trying to play but the game only comes up in a central box that makes it diff to scroll and read the tiny words. I went to the icon on my desktop and went to properties then maximized the screen, but it still occurs. any suggestions?
 
Go to your Hearts of Iron settings (it will be inside the directory where you installed it or on your programs list.) Once there, you can change the resolution (in your case make it smaller), enable/disable music, etc...

Is this on a laptop? Sounds like your desktop resolution is higher than the game resolution and your system is not set up to always run full screen. On my Dell Inspiron 8200 using the "Fn+F7" (labelled 'Font') keys toggles this behaviour. It's a hardware function with LCD panels, not Windows. AFAIK the game is ALWAYS full-screen as far as Windows is concerned.
